What's the best neigborhood in Partick for sightseeing?
North West is a popular part of the city for sightseeing with top places to visit like Botanic Gardens, Riverside Museum, and Kelvingrove Art Gallery and Museum.

Head over to Kelvinhall Station to catch metro. To see more of the surrounding area, ride one of the trains from Glasgow Partick Station or Hyndland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Partick for your journey.
What's the weather like in Partick?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 56°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 39°F. Average annual precipitation for Partick is 56 inches.
